Why Locals Love Jiang Nan Flushing

Jiang Nan Flushing offers an exquisite journey into authentic Chinese cuisine right in the heart of Flushing, NY. Specializing in a diverse array of traditional dishes, this restaurant beautifully captures the rich flavors and aromatic spices emblematic of Jiangnan regional cooking, known for its balance, freshness, and elegance.

The menu is a treasure trove for those eager to explore both comforting classics and unique specialties. Among the vegetable selections, dishes like Sauteed Water Spinach with Fermented Bean Curd Sauce and Spicy & Sour Shredded Potato stand out with their vibrant textures and bright, tangy notes. For lovers of seafood and meats, the StirFried Grass Fish Fillet delivers a perfectly fragrant and tender bite, while the Deep Fried Shredded Eel with Dried Chili offers a wonderful balance of crispy edges and spicy heat. Highlighted repeatedly by customers, the Peking Duck is a sublime creation—its skin crisped to perfection, with tender, flavorful meat inside that leaves a lasting impression long after the last bite.

Dining here is more than just a meal; it is a complete sensory experience. The presentation of dishes like the Crispy Shrimp with Honey Walnuts and Sliced Marbled Beef in Golden Pepper Broth is nothing short of artistic, enhancing every taste with visual appeal. The desserts, including a lavish Creme Brulee and a delightfully spiced Gluten Rice Cake with Brown Sugar, provide a sweet, satisfying finish to the meal.

The atmosphere at Jiang Nan Flushing exudes warmth and sophistication. Guests frequently note the welcoming hospitality and attentive service, creating a cozy yet refined dining environment that is perfect for both intimate dinners and celebratory gatherings. Whether you arrive late on a holiday or join a group for a lively meal, the restaurant’s inviting ambiance makes every visit feel special.

Customer reviews consistently praise not only the authentic flavors but also the restaurant’s thoughtful touches—such as the complimentary pickled appetizers infused with aromatic chili oil—that heighten the overall enjoyment. The fusion of fresh ingredients, expert preparation, and gracious service ensures that Jiang Nan Flushing is a must-visit destination for anyone craving an elevated Chinese dining experience in New York.
